Concerns raised over Alam Maritim’s accounts


“We draw attention to Note 2.1 of the financial statements which indicates that the group had incurred a loss for the FY20 of RM119.83mil and its current liabilities exceeded its current assets by RM20.25mil as at Dec 31, 2020, ” MAJ said.

PETALING JAYA: Alam Maritim Resources Bhd’s independent auditor Messrs Al Jafree Salihin Kuzaimi PLT (MAJ) has expressed an unqualified opinion with material uncertainty related to the company as a going concern.

This relates to the financial statements of the group for the financial year ended Dec 31, 2020 (FY20), a statement issued to the Bursa Malaysia yesterday said.
